Touring cycling in Plovdiv Region offers diverse landscapes, from the flat plains along the Maritsa River to the challenging ascents of the Rhodope Mountains. The region features a network of routes that traverse agricultural lands, dense forests, and historical sites. Terrain varies from well-maintained riverside paths to unpaved mountain segments, providing options for different skill levels.

Best tou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region

  • The most popular touring cycling route is Roman Aqueduct of Plovdiv – Maritsa Riverbank loop from Вагоно-Ремонтно Депо, an easy 18.6 miles (29.9 km) trail that takes 1 hour 47 minutes to complete. This route follows the Maritsa Riverbank and passes the historic Roman Aqueduct.
  • Another top favourite among local touring cyclists is Hotel Ostrova loop from Христо Смирненски, an easy 4.9 miles (7.9 km) path. This short route offers a quick ride through urban green spaces.
  • Local touring cyclists also love the Maritsa Riverside Cycle Path – Lauta Park loop from Plovdiv, an 8.9 miles (14.4 km) trail leading through riverside areas and Lauta Park, often completed in about 50 minutes.

Plovdiv is the only city in Europe comprising three protected areas, with the biggest one being "Youth Hill" covering 36.2 ha. "Youth Hill" Natural Landmark was designated by the Ministry of Environment and Water by virtue of Ordinance No RD-466/22.12.1995. The natural landmark status preserves "Youth Hill" against any new construction, except for the maintenance of existing buildings, alleys, and park facilities. The protection regime of the hill provides for the preservation of the rocks and the natural park vegetation, non-disturbance of birds, non-encroachment on birds eggs, offspring, and nests. Lighting fire on the hill is also prohibited. Observing these rules, we can protect and preserve "Youth Hill" as an area of great significance for the relaxation and recreational needs of the big city. Fantastic View over Plovdiv

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available in Plovdiv Region?

Plovdiv Region offers a wide selection of touring cycling routes, with over 60 options available on komoot. These routes cater to various preferences, from leisurely rides to more challenging ascents.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

The region boasts diverse terrain. You can find leisurely rides along the flat, well-maintained paths of the Maritsa River, offering scenic views. For more challenging experiences, the Rhodope Mountains provide routes with significant elevation gains, winding through dense forests and past stunning rock formations. Terrain varies from paved roads to unpaved mountain segments.

What is the best time of year for touring cycling in Plovdiv Region?

The Plovdiv Region generally has a mild climate, making many areas, especially the Rhodope Mountains, favorable for outdoor pursuits even during colder months. Spring and autumn typically offer pleasant temperatures for cycling, while summer can be warm, particularly in the lowlands. Always check local weather conditions before your ride.

Are there easy touring cycling routes suitable for beginners in Plovdiv Region?

Yes, Plovdiv Region has numerous easy touring cycling routes. For example, the Hotel Ostrova loop from Христо Смирненски is an easy 4.9-mile (7.9 km) path offering a quick ride through urban green spaces. Another accessible option is the Roman Aqueduct of Plovdiv – Maritsa Riverbank loop from Вагоно-Ремонтно Депо, an easy 18.6-mile (29.9 km) trail following the Maritsa Riverbank.

Can I find circular tou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

Many tou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the Maritsa Riverside Cycle Path – Lauta Park loop from Plovdiv, which is 8.9 miles (14.4 km), or the longer Cycling Spot in Plovdiv loop from Plovdiv, covering 11.2 miles (18 km).

What historical sites can I explore along tou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

Cycling routes often incorporate visits to significant historical sites. You can explore the captivating Roman Stadium and Dzhumaya Mosque, Plovdiv, or the Ancient Theatre of Philippopolis within Plovdiv Old Town. Further afield, routes can lead to medieval sites like Asen's Fortress or the ancient Starosel Thracian Temple.

Are there natural attractions to see while cycling in Plovdiv Region?

Absolutely. The Rhodope Mountains are a major draw, featuring plummeting river gorges, soaring peaks, and majestic coniferous forests. You might encounter iconic natural phenomena like the 'Wonderful Bridges' or the serene Chairski lakes. High peaks such as Botev Peak offer panoramic vistas.

Are there family-friendly tou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

Yes, the region offers routes suitable for families, particularly those along the Maritsa River, which are mostly flat and well-maintained. These paths provide a safe and enjoyable experience for cyclists of all ages. Shorter loops within urban green spaces, like the Hotel Ostrova loop from Христо Смирненски, are also great for families.

What are some notable viewpoints on tou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

Many routes offer scenic viewpoints, especially those venturing into the Rhodope Mountains. You can enjoy panoramic views from higher elevations, such as those found on routes near Botev Peak or along the Maritsa River, where routes like View of the Maritsa River – Maritsa Riverbank loop from Орхидея provide picturesque perspectives.

Are there challenging tou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

For experienced touring cyclists seeking a challenge, Plovdiv Region offers several difficult routes, particularly in the Rhodope Mountains. An example is the Mladezhki Halm (Hill of Youth) – Roman Aqueduct of Plovdiv loop from Централна гара Пловдив, a difficult 27.6-mile (44.4 km) route with significant elevation gain. Another demanding option is the Lauta Park – The Singing Fountains loop from Тракия, spanning 29.7 miles (47.8 km).

What do other touring cyclists enjoy the most about touring cycling in Plovdiv Region?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ars. Reviewers often praise the diverse landscapes, from the serene Maritsa River paths to the challenging Rhodope Mountain trails, and the opportunity to combine cycling with exploring historical sites like the Roman Aqueduct. The variety of routes catering to different skill levels is also frequently highlighted.

Are there places to eat or stay along the touring cycling routes?

Yes, many routes pass through traditional villages such as Shiroka Laka, Chepelare, and Borino, where you can find local eateries and accommodation. Within Plovdiv city and its immediate surroundings, there are numerous cafes and restaurants. For longer mountain tours, you might encounter huts like Kozya Stena Hut or Rai Hut (Central Balkan National Park), offering rest and refreshments.

What are the options for public transport access to touring cycling routes in Plovdiv Region?

Plovdiv, as a major city, has good public transport connections. While specific rules for bikes on public transport can vary, local buses and trains often connect to towns and areas near popular cycling routes. It's advisable to check with local transport providers for current regulations regarding bicycle carriage, especially for longer journeys into the mountains.
